After being arrested you must be arraigned within two court days. The arraignment hearing is where you plead guilty or not guilty. After that is the preliminary hearing. "During the preliminary hearing (usually within 10 court days of the arraignment), the district attorney’s office must present evidence showing a reasonable suspicion that a felony was committed and that you did it. The judge must be convinced that there is sufficient evidence to bring you to trial. If the judge does not dismiss the charges after the preliminary hearing, a jury trial date will be set."
